Power Transmission And Motion Control Market: Supporting Modern Industrial Automation

The Power Transmission And Motion Control Market plays an important role in industrial operations by enabling machinery to transfer power and perform controlled movement. Components such as gears, bearings, belts, chains, couplings, motors, actuators, drives, and control systems are essential across manufacturing, automotive, material handling, energy, and process industries. Increasing industrial automation and demand for efficient machinery are contributing to continued interest in advanced power transmission and motion control technologies.

Modern manufacturing facilities require precise, reliable, and efficient movement of machines and materials. Power transmission components convert and transfer mechanical energy, while motion control systems regulate speed, position, acceleration, and torque. Together, these technologies support automated production lines and improve machine performance.

Role in Industrial Automation

Automation is one of the major areas influencing the industry. Automated equipment requires accurate motion control to perform repetitive operations consistently. Servo motors, variable-frequency drives, controllers, sensors, and actuators enable machines to execute programmed movements with increasing precision.

Industries such as electronics manufacturing, packaging, food processing, pharmaceuticals, and automotive production depend on controlled motion. As factories introduce robotics and automated production equipment, demand for high-performance transmission and motion-control components can increase.

Focus on Energy Efficiency

Energy efficiency has become an important consideration for industrial operators. Inefficient motors, mechanical transmission systems, and poorly optimized machines can increase operating expenses. Manufacturers are therefore developing products designed to reduce friction, minimize energy losses, and improve overall machine efficiency.

Advanced drives and intelligent control systems can adjust motor operation according to production requirements. Monitoring technologies can also help identify abnormal operating conditions and maintenance requirements, potentially reducing unnecessary energy consumption and equipment downtime.

Technological Advancements

Digital technologies are changing how power transmission and motion control equipment is monitored and managed. Connected sensors can collect information on vibration, temperature, speed, load, and other operating parameters. This data can support predictive maintenance strategies and improve asset visibility.

The integration of industrial communication networks also allows motion-control equipment to exchange information with programmable logic controllers, manufacturing execution systems, and broader industrial automation platforms. Such integration supports coordinated machine operation and more responsive production environments.

Applications Across Key Industries

The automotive sector uses transmission and motion-control equipment throughout assembly, material handling, machining, and testing operations. Warehousing and logistics facilities rely on conveyors, automated storage systems, sortation equipment, and robotic platforms that require precise movement.

Renewable energy equipment also creates opportunities for power transmission technologies. Wind turbines, solar tracking systems, and other energy infrastructure depend on mechanical and electronic systems capable of handling demanding operating conditions.
